The Las Vegas Raiders are facing familiar challenges in their efforts to transform into a successful team, with this season continuing a pattern of underperformance. Through seven games, the Raiders hold a 2-5 record, and their situation is deteriorating rapidly, prompting a reevaluation during their current bye week to prepare for the second half of the season.
Head coach Pete Carroll, in his first season with the Raiders, has not seen the desired results, as the team has struggled to compete consistently as a unit. Carroll aims to use the bye week to reassess the roster, identifying players who are fully committed to the team's improvement and those who may need to be removed to foster progress.
In a recent episode of the Las Vegas Raiders Insider Podcast, Hondo Carpenter discussed the team's state, noting that the Raiders are performing worse than last season by nearly all metrics. Carpenter highlighted that owner Mark Davis is not considering terminating Pete Carroll's contract, emphasizing the need for the franchise to address deeper questions about its direction and immediate repairs.
Carpenter further defended Carroll, stating that the Raiders' primary consistency has been inconsistency, and firing coaches has not resolved underlying issues. He asserted that Carroll is a capable coach and dismissed claims that the game has passed him by as ignorant, urging a focus on stability rather than further changes in leadership.
